According to an RJC auditor, suppliers just require to promise that they carry out strong civils rights due persistance, yet do not give any type of proof for this. Neither does the Code of Practices require jewelersor other downstream companiesto have traceability or chain of custody of their gold or rubies. The Code of Practices is also weak in other substantive areas, as an example, on indigenous individuals' civil liberties and on resettlement.In March 2017, the RJC had 342 members that had not (yet) finished the audit process that licenses compliance with the Code of Practices. On top of that, firms can join at any type of level of their operations. As an example, a tiny subsidiary workplace of a large precious jewelry firm might obtain RJC membership, without including the rest of the firm's entities.
Lastly, the Code of Practices does not require firms to openly report on the concrete actions they have taken to perform due diligencea core requirement of the OECD Guidance. Its reporting obligations are unclear and do not discuss due persistance or the requirement for companies to report on the steps they have actually required to determine, assess, and minimize threats in their supply chains

A 2nd RJC standard, the Chain-of-Custody Criterion, advertises traceability and is much more strenuous, however adherence to it is optional for RJC members. By very early 2018, just 48 of over 1,000 member companies had actually certified entities under the criterion, including 13 jewelers. The Chain-of-Custody Requirement needs business to establish documentary evidence of business transactions along the supply chain and to validate they are not causing unfavorable impacts in conflict-affected and high-risk locations.
Rather, companies are permitted to select some "entities" under their control for qualification, leaving various other entities of a business uncertified. While this might permit business to progressively switch to more liable sourcing practices, the present practice also carries the danger that a whole firm enjoys the reputational benefit when most of procedures is not in compliance with the criterion.
All RJC participant companies have to undertake an audit to show that they are compliant with the Code of Practices, and to receive certification. Those companies that select to acquire accreditation for the Chain-of-Custody Standard have to go through a separate audit. Audits are based mostly on a testimonial of the business's composed plans and paperwork, and check outs to a "depictive set" of facilities.

Audits are intended to consist of questions on a wide variety of human civil liberties, auditors are not constantly qualified human legal rights experts (engagement rings). When the auditors finish their report, they just send a recap record of the audit to the RJC, not the complete audit report, which is shared only with the business
While labor abuses prevail in the field, artisanal mines provide income for countless employees and hundreds of mining areas. Human Rights Watch thinks that the jewelry sector need to make every effort to make sure that their initiatives to alleviate supply chain civils rights dangers do not lead them to simply exclude all artisanal suppliers from their supply chains as the "course of the very least resistance." Instead, they should sustain initiatives to formalize and professionalize artisanal mines and improve functioning problems.
The OECD Charge Persistance Support acknowledges this and is promoting cost-sharing within the market. This way, all companies along the supply chain share the financial worry. A variety of efforts have emerged that can aid jewelry experts trace their gold and rubies to mines of origin, and much more responsibly resource from the artisanal industry.

Two standardscertify artisanal and small gold mines that adjust to human rights, labor rights, and ecological standardsthe Fairmined Requirement and the Fairtrade Gold Criterion (diamond earrings). Depending on the consumer's permit with Fairmined, the gold may be completely deducible to the mine of beginning, or might be blended with other gold.
This amount is just a small portion of the gold made use of annually by several of the business taken a look at in this record. Since early 2018, eight mines in four nations (Bolivia, Colombia, Mongolia, and Peru) were certified, with an additional 20 mining companies working towards qualification. The Fairmined Gold Criterion is presently establishing a brand-new "market entrance" requirement that seeks to aid artisanal cash cow at the same time towards full qualification.
